    Sourcing Your First Stamps for PenniesAcquiring stamps on a budget is surprisingly easy if you know where to look. One of the best methods is purchasing kiloware. This term refers to bulk assortments of used stamps, often still on their original paper clippings, sold by weight. You can buy a large packet of hundreds of mixed international stamps online for the price of a fancy vacation coffee. Sorting through a pile of kiloware on a rainy vacation afternoon provides hours of entertainment as you hunt for pieces that match your theme.Another excellent source is local ephemera. While exploring new towns, drop by small antique malls, thrift stores, or community yard sales. Sellers often have boxes of old postcards, letters, and loose stamps tucked away in corners. These sellers are usually happy to part with these items for very little money. You can also ask family members and friends to save envelopes from their incoming international mail, instantly giving you a zero-cost supply of modern specimens.

    Essential Tools for the Budget PhilatelistGetting started does not require professional-grade laboratory equipment. You can assemble a highly functional starter kit for less than the cost of a single movie ticket. The most critical tool is a pair of stamp tongs. These are specialized tweezers with smooth, rounded tips designed to handle delicate paper without leaving oily fingerprints or tearing the edges. Using regular household tweezers can permanently damage stamps, so investing a few dollars in proper tongs is well worth it.To store your treasures, a simple stockbook with clear pockets is ideal for beginners. It allows you to arrange and rearrange your stamps easily without using sticky hinges or mounts. For those on an absolute shoestring budget, a plain school binder with clear plastic sheet protectors works beautifully. Add a cheap plastic magnifying glass from a convenience store, and you have everything needed to examine the microscopic details, hidden watermarks, and beautiful engraving work on your budget discoveries.

    It Takes Two stands as the definitive pinnacle of purely cooperative video game design, built entirely around the absolute necessity of absolute teamwork. Developed by Hazelight Studios and widely accessible across PC, PlayStation, Xbox, and Nintendo Switch, this platforming adventure cannot be played alone. It forces two participants to step into the roles of Cody and May, an estranged couple transformed into small yarn and clay dolls. The brilliant execution of the game lies in its asymmetric mechanics, ensuring that every level equips the two siblings with completely different, yet complementary, tools. One player might wield a hammerhead to smash obstacles while the other shoots nails to pin platforms in place, forcing continuous communication and synchronization. The shifting environments, which range from a chaotic garden overrun by weaponized wasps to a magical retro clocktower, ensure that gameplay never grows repetitive. Because progress is completely impossible without mutual assistance, it serves as an excellent vehicle for brothers and sisters to practice problem-solving and celebrate joint triumphs.     Portal 2 provides a masterclass in collaborative logical reasoning through its dedicated, standalone cooperative campaign. Available on PC, Xbox, and Nintendo Switch, this physics-based puzzle game places siblings in control of two adorable testing robots named Atlas and P-Body. Armed with separate portal guns, the duo must navigate complex chambers by manipulating spatial geometry, momentum, and laser beams. The puzzle mechanics explicitly require four distinct portals to solve, meaning neither sibling can advance through the chamber without the precise assistance of the other. This design structure completely eliminates any possibility of one player dominating the game or leaving the other behind. The experience relies entirely on shared “aha!” moments, encouraging siblings to verbalize their thoughts, experiment with trial-and-error mechanics, and rely heavily on precise timing. Wrapped in a layer of witty, dark corporate humor, it transforms complex intellectual challenges into a highly rewarding bonding exercise.
